Comparison

Manchester vs Nashua

Nashua has the lower salary-needed estimate, while Manchester has the lower starter rent. Differences are shown as Nashua minus Manchester.

MetricManchesterNashuaDifferenceAdvantageWhy
Median rent$2,018$2,181+$163ManchesterManchester has the lower median rent.
Home price$441,257$507,692+$66,435ManchesterManchester has the lower home price.
Utilities$219/mo$225/mo+$6/moManchesterManchester has the lower utilities.
Groceries index107108+1ManchesterManchester has the lower groceries index.
Salary needed$92,340$81,000-$11,340NashuaNashua has the lower salary needed.
Move score74/10071/100-3ManchesterManchester has the higher move score.
